Tokyopop now working with Gentosha to stay alive


8:51 PM on 07.28.2008
Tokyopop now working with Gentosha to stay alive photo



Keeping themselves afloat, Tokyopop has announced a deal with Gentosha comics to be a place to provide "sublicensing agency services" for Gentosha's series, outside of Asia, France, and Italy. We've seen the two companies bumping uglies before when they worked on Rozen Maiden, Gravitation, and Lament of the Lamb.

Besides the publishing end of things, the two companies are going to be working together towards "co-development opportunities in the digital, film, and merchandising spaces." So, the new branch of Tokyopop is finally going to have something new to work with as they start shopping around Hollywood. They've got to compete with Viz and Sueisha-Shogakugan Productions.
